Learn more about Llanymynech

Cross the historic Llanymynech Limeworks Heritage Area to explore limestone kilns and walking paths along the Montgomery Canal. Golf enthusiasts can play a unique course that straddles the Welsh-English border, while history buffs enjoy the Heritage Centre's exhibits about local mining.

Best time to go to Llanymynech

The best time to visit Llanymynech can depend on the weather and when visitor numbers rise and fall. The hottest average temperature in Llanymynech falls in July, when visitor numbers are slightly high and weather is mostly cloudy with light rain. The coolest average temperature in Llanymynech falls in January, visitor numbers are average and weather is mostly cloudy with light rain.

calendar iconCalendar Monthtemperature iconTemperaturerain iconPrecipitationmostly cloudy iconCloudinessoccupation rate iconOccupancyprice iconPricing
January38.3°F (3.5°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ageSlightly Low
February39.4°F (4.1°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ageSlightly Low
March41.7°F (5.4°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ageSlightly Low
April45.9°F (7.7°C)No RainMostly CloudySlightly HighAverage
May51.3°F (10.7°C)Light RainMostly CloudySlightly HighSlightly High
June56.8°F (13.8°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ageSlightly High
July59.9°F (15.5°C)Light RainMostly CloudySlightly HighSlightly High
August59.0°F (15.0°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ageAverage
September55.4°F (13.0°C)Light RainMostly CloudyAverageAverage
October50.4°F (10.2°C)Light RainMostly CloudySlightly LowAverage
November44.1°F (6.7°C)Light RainMostly CloudySlightly LowAverage
December40.3°F (4.6°C)Light RainMostly CloudySlightly LowAverage

What's the seasonal weather in Llanymynech?
The hottest months are usually July and August, with an average temperature of 14°C, while the coldest months are January and February, with an average of 4°C. Average annual precipitation for Llanymynech is 795 mm.
